This talk will serve to introduce the audience to the “path of radical love” (mazhab-e ‘eshq), a powerful current of mysticism in Islam that begins with a bold claim: There is, ultimately, One Love.
This talk by Professor Safi, the Director of Islamic Studies at Duke University, will also serve as an introduction to how to read Rumi as a Muslim sage. Following the talk, join us for a lively on-stage conversation with Professor Safi and the Bay Area's own Feraidoon Mojadedi.

Listen to story @ 2:00:00 Dua reminder :) رَبِّ ابْنِ لِي عِنْدَكَ بَيْتًا فِي الْجَنَّةِ. “My Lord, build for me near You a house in Paradise”. Quran 66:11 These words spoken by Asiyah, the wife of Pharaoh, are part of a supplication that exemplifies her faith and dependence on Allah. She was neither affected by her husband’s hatred for the truth nor by his efforts to destroy the Believers. Instead, she recognized the truth when she saw it and accepted it. She then sought Allah’s help against the evil of her people and asked Him to grant her a home near Him in Paradise. -Ibn Katheer and others.
